MOSCOW, December 18. /TASS/. Signing an inter-Libyan political settlement may become the starting point for restoring Libyan statehood, the Russian Foreign Ministry said in a statement on Friday.
"We are interested in the establishment of Libya as a stable democratic state based on efficient state institutions, including the army and security forces," the document said. "This is in line not only with the hopes of the Libyan people but also with the interests of the entire region of the Middle East and North Africa, international community in general," the foreign ministry added.
The agreement on inter-Libyan political settlement was signed on December 17 in Morocco with UN participation. It envisages establishing a presidential council, a national accord government and other unified institutions.
